Understanding Your Financing Options at Toyota Financial Services Sandton
So, you're at Toyota Financial Services Sandton, ready to talk finance, but what are your actual options, right? This is where things get exciting, guys! They've got a pretty sweet setup designed to cater to a wide range of needs. The most common one you’ll hear about is, of course, vehicle finance. This is your standard car loan, where you borrow money to buy the car, and then you pay it back over a set period with interest. Easy peasy. But Toyota Financial Services Sandton goes a step further. They offer different types of vehicle finance, like fixed interest rates (where your monthly payments stay the same, which is great for budgeting) or variable interest rates (which might fluctuate but could potentially save you money if rates drop). They also offer options with or without a balloon payment. A balloon payment is basically a larger lump sum you pay at the end of your finance term. It means your monthly installments are lower during the loan period, which can be super helpful if you want to keep your monthly expenses down. Just remember, you’ll need to have that lump sum ready at the end, or you might need to finance it again.
Then there's the option of leasing. Leasing is a bit different from buying. Instead of owning the car outright, you're essentially renting it for a fixed period, usually between two to four years. You make monthly payments, and at the end of the lease term, you usually have the option to hand the car back, buy it for a predetermined price, or sometimes even upgrade to a newer model. Leasing can be awesome if you like driving a new car every few years and don't want to worry about depreciation or selling your old car. Toyota Financial Services Sandton can walk you through whether leasing or buying is the better fit for your lifestyle and financial goals. They also offer insurance and value-added products. This isn't strictly finance, but it's crucial! They can help you sort out things like comprehensive car insurance, scratch and dent repair plans, and extended warranties. These add-ons can give you peace of mind and protect you from unexpected costs down the line. Basically, Toyota Financial Services Sandton aims to be your one-stop shop, making sure you not only get the car you want but also have the financial and protective layers sorted.

Tips for a Smooth Financing Experience
So, you’re heading to Toyota Financial Services Sandton or maybe just preparing for the process. To make sure everything goes off without a hitch, guys, here are a few pro tips to keep in mind. First and foremost, get your finances in order before you go. This means having a clear understanding of your budget. How much can you really afford per month, including insurance, fuel, and maintenance? Knowing this will help you narrow down your car choices and avoid falling in love with a car that’s just out of your price range. Check your credit score beforehand too! You can usually get a free credit report from one of the major credit bureaus in South Africa. Knowing your score helps you understand what kind of interest rates you might qualify for and if there are any issues you need to address before applying.
Be honest and accurate on your application. When you fill out the finance application, ensure all the information you provide is truthful and precise. Small inaccuracies can sometimes lead to delays or even the rejection of your application. This includes employment details, income, and expenses. Transparency is your best friend here. Prepare all your necessary documents in advance. As we mentioned, having your ID, proof of address, proof of income (payslips, bank statements), and any other requested documents ready to go will significantly speed up the process. Having them organized in a folder makes it super easy for the dealership staff.
Understand the terms and conditions. Don't just skim over the finance agreement! Take the time to read it thoroughly. Ask questions about anything you don't understand, especially regarding the interest rate (is it fixed or variable?), the total amount payable, any fees involved, and what happens if you miss a payment or want to settle the loan early. Knowing the fine print protects you. Consider the total cost of ownership, not just the monthly installment. A lower monthly payment might sound appealing, but if it means a longer loan term with more interest paid overall, or a large balloon payment at the end, it might not be the best deal. Think about insurance, fuel consumption, and potential maintenance costs associated with the specific Toyota model you choose.
Shop around, but leverage the dealership relationship. While it’s always good to compare finance offers from different institutions, remember that Toyota Financial Services Sandton often provides competitive rates and tailored packages specifically for Toyota vehicles. Sometimes, the dealership can negotiate better terms with TFS than you might get on your own. Discuss your options openly with the F&I manager. Finally, don’t be afraid to negotiate. While the car price is the main negotiation point, there might be some flexibility on the finance terms or associated products like warranties or service plans. A polite and informed negotiation can sometimes lead to a better overall deal.
